Advanced Training in Sustainability and Technology at UFSCar
The Federal University of São Carlos (UFSCar) announces the opening of registrations for the online specialization course in Management and Technologies for Sustainability. This graduate program offers an in-depth immersion in the concepts, techniques, and technological tools related to the field of Environmental Sciences, with the main objective of fostering the protection, conservation, and effective management of the natural space and biodiversity.
The course is meticulously designed to meet the growing needs of qualified professionals to mitigate the negative impacts of human activity on the environment, providing them with the knowledge and skills necessary to collect, process, and analyze crucial data and information for the sustainable management of natural resources involved in the production and consumption of goods and services.
A Comprehensive Curriculum Oriented Toward the Future
The curriculum structure of the course covers a wide range of essential topics, from governance and management of environmental impacts to project planning, economic valuation of environmental liabilities and assets, efficient use of renewable resources, and environmental legislation, assessment, and certification. These contents are essential for professionals seeking not only to understand but also to implement sustainable and technologically advanced practices in their organizations.

The Department of Environmental Sciences (DCA-So) at UFSCar, located at the Sorocaba Campus, is the promoter of this specialization course in Management and Technologies for Sustainability (EaD), which has a total duration of 360 class hours. Classes are scheduled to start in March, and those interested in diving into the tools and strategies for sustainability management can already enroll.
